CVE-2017-12967
medium
CVSS v3
6.5
CVSS v2
4.3
VIR risk
6.5
Description
The getsym function in tekhex.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29, allows remote attackers to cause a denial of service (stack-based buffer over-read and application crash) via a malformed tekhex binary.
Predictions
Exploit likelihood
75%
Patch ETA
—
Heuristic predictions, AS-IS, for prioritization only.
Mitigations
Vendor advisory: suse — https://www.suse.com/security/cve/CVE-2017-12967.html
Vendor advisory: debian — https://security-tracker.debian.org/tracker/CVE-2017-12967
Vendor advisory: cve@mitre.org — https://sourceware.org/bugzilla/show_bug.cgi?id=21962
OS impact
| OS | Version | Status | Fixed in |
|---|---|---|---|
| debian | bookworm | fixed | 2.29-5 |
| debian | bullseye | fixed | 2.29-5 |
| debian | forky | fixed | 2.29-5 |
| debian | sid | fixed | 2.29-5 |
| debian | trixie | fixed | 2.29-5 |
| sles | affected | |
Application impact
| Vendor | Product | Versions | Fixed |
|---|---|---|---|
| gnu | binutils | 2.29 | |
References
CWEs
CWE-125
Verify integrity in audit chain (admin only). AS-IS.